: The BAU identifies him as an "omnivore," meaning he does not target a specific victim type. He is described as a highly disciplined predator who kills anyone to maintain a sense of dominance and recognition.

: Foyet originally appears in the episode as a victim who survived a previous Reaper attack. This allows him to stay close to the investigation until the team realizes his true identity.
